Introduction
In an era where first impressions often happen online, your website is the digital storefront of your business. Whether you’re a local service provider or a global e-commerce brand, having a professionally built, optimized, and strategically designed website is essential for credibility, visibility, and growth.
This in-depth guide explores the essential components of modern web development that every business—large or small—needs to succeed online. From design and performance to security and SEO, we’ll break down what it really takes to build a website that works for your goals and your audience.
1. Mobile-Responsive Design
More than half of all website traffic comes from mobile devices. If your website isn’t responsive, you risk losing potential customers at first glance.
Why It Matters:
-
Improves user experience across devices
-
Enhances SEO rankings (Google prioritizes mobile-friendly sites)
-
Reduces bounce rates
Tip: Use flexible layouts, scalable images, and media queries to ensure your design adapts to any screen size.
2. Fast Loading Speed
Website speed is directly tied to user experience and SEO. A delay of just one second in page load time can lead to a 7% reduction in conversions.
Key Practices:
-
Optimize images and videos
-
Minify CSS, HTML, and JavaScript files
-
Use reliable hosting and a CDN (Content Delivery Network)
-
Enable caching
Recommended Tools: Google PageSpeed Insights, GTmetrix, WebPageTest.org
3. Clear Site Architecture & Navigation
Your website should be easy to navigate. A logical structure helps users find information quickly—and makes it easier for search engines to index your site.
Essentials:
-
Simple and intuitive menu structure
-
Clear CTAs (calls to action)
-
Internal linking strategy
-
XML sitemap for search engines
4. SEO Fundamentals
Without search engine optimization, your website won’t get found by potential customers. Basic on-site SEO should be baked into your web development process.
Must-Have Elements:
-
Keyword-optimized page titles and meta descriptions
-
Header tags (H1, H2, H3) for content structure
-
Alt text for images
-
Schema markup for rich snippets
-
Secure HTTPS protocol (SSL certificate)
5. CMS or Custom Code?
Choosing the right framework is crucial. For most small to mid-sized businesses, a CMS (Content Management System) like WordPress, Shopify, or Webflow is ideal. Larger businesses may benefit from custom-developed sites using frameworks like Laravel, React, or Next.js.
CMS Benefits:
-
Easy to update content
-
Pre-built themes and plugins
-
Lower development costs
Custom Code Benefits:
-
Full control over functionality
-
Enhanced performance
-
Scalable and tailored to specific needs
6. Accessibility & Inclusivity
A truly effective website is accessible to all users, including those with disabilities. Accessibility also reduces legal risks and expands your potential audience.
Best Practices:
-
Use proper contrast ratios and readable fonts
-
Add ARIA labels and skip navigation links
-
Ensure keyboard navigation works
-
Use semantic HTML
7. Security Measures
Cybersecurity is a growing concern for businesses and users alike. A secure website builds trust and protects sensitive data.
Core Security Essentials:
-
SSL certificate (HTTPS)
-
Regular software updates (CMS, plugins, frameworks)
-
Strong password protocols and 2FA
-
Firewall and malware scanning
-
Secure backups and recovery systems
8. Conversion Optimization
Your website should guide visitors toward taking meaningful action—whether that’s filling out a contact form, making a purchase, or subscribing to your newsletter.
Tactics to Implement:
-
Prominent CTAs on every page
-
Lead capture forms and chatbots
-
A/B testing of headlines and buttons
-
Trust signals: reviews, testimonials, certifications
9. Integration With Tools & Marketing Platforms
Modern websites integrate with CRM systems, email marketing tools, analytics, and other platforms to streamline business processes.
Examples:
-
Google Analytics or GA4 for performance tracking
-
HubSpot or Mailchimp for marketing automation
-
Zapier or Make (Integromat) for workflow automation
10. Ongoing Maintenance and Optimization
Launching a website is just the beginning. Regular audits and updates keep your site performing at its best and aligned with your business goals.
Checklist:
-
Monthly performance audits
-
Quarterly content updates
-
Yearly design and UX reviews
-
Continuous SEO improvements
Conclusion
Your website is one of your most valuable marketing assets. By focusing on these ten essentials—design, performance, security, SEO, and conversion—you’ll ensure your site not only looks good but delivers measurable business value.
Need help developing or auditing your website? Our team of developers and designers specializes in building powerful, high-converting digital experiences tailored to your brand. Contact us to schedule a free consultation.